The ‘Vestigium’ project has introduced new information panels in Chiclana, detailing the rich history of the coastline, including La Barrosa beach and defensive towers.

The mayor of Chiclana, José María Román, and the delegate for Beaches, Ana González, attended the presentation of the ‘Vestigium’ project in Chiclana. The project includes the unveiling of informative panels on the history of La Barrosa beach. They were accompanied by Milagros Alzaga, head of the Underwater Archaeology Centre of the Andalusian Institute of Historical Heritage (IAPH), and Marta Sameño, Director of Research and Transfer at IAPH. They visited the Torre del Puerco and Torre Bermeja.
Mayor Román highlighted that the IAPH project serves to remember the significance of the historical heritage of the Cádiz coast, an area that witnessed battles like Trafalgar and the Battle of La Barrosa, and is now a prominent tourist destination. He noted that visitors can enrich their experience by learning about the history alongside the natural spaces.
Milagros Alzaga emphasized that the ‘Vestigium’ Project, funded by European and Junta de Andalucía funds, focused a significant part of its year-and-a-half research on Chiclana's coastline. The panels showcase findings such as Pleistocene shell middens and 16th-century watchtowers.
The shipwreck of the vessel ‘Soberbio’ in 1752 off the coast of Chiclana was mentioned, which led to the establishment of a salvage camp. The head of the Underwater Archaeology Centre explained that this event prompted the creation of what is considered the first beach bar in Andalusia. The panels feature QR codes for audio descriptions and a video about the history of La Barrosa.
